Biden's Gaffe in Oval Office Address Draws Media Scrutiny
President Biden's mispronunciation during a speech on political violence raises questions about his communication clarity.
- Biden referred to the 'battle box' instead of the ballot box multiple times during his address.
- The speech aimed to condemn political violence following an assassination attempt on Donald Trump.
- Media outlets differed in their coverage, with some editing out the gaffe.
- The incident has reignited discussions about Biden's verbal missteps and fitness for office.
- Calls for Biden to step down have resurfaced within his party.
